Palm Tree Island
A quiet anchorage off a small Intracoastal Waterway island made notable by a lone palm tree planted there by a local family — now a beloved coastal landmark. It's the kind of quirky, story-rich spot you'll want to drop anchor near just to say you did, with the calm waters of the ICW surrounding you on all sides.
